Transaction 17333f1436e1d9db51f2220f76b0731054960c98aa6ae2a265ad9a31afcc8cd5

1 Input
2 Outputs
  • 17333f1436e1d9db51f2220f76b0731054960c98aa6ae2a265ad9a31afcc8cd5:0
  • value  7409638
    address  35FWdparPCYrxER9dMJiSPCq9o57YuubaR
  • 17333f1436e1d9db51f2220f76b0731054960c98aa6ae2a265ad9a31afcc8cd5:1
  • value  3353871
    address  3QEPJNpxk1R7aVZuDVsHB6GFcmi7f8FPtM